@shankypanky Interesting, though Ventura's worldview diverges sharply from RFK in many respects while Rogers is very much aligned with him. Lets look at one interesting example. Ventura ripped the anti-mask crowd during covid as pathetically unwilling to sacrifice for the greater good, saying Hitler would have won against today's America. "The country sacrificed in WWII. Do you think there would have been any argument over wearing a mask for the people of WWII? I’ll tell you if we behaved like we are right now, Hitler would have won," said Ventura. "He’d a won because this country won’t face any type of – they don't want to sacrifice." RFK Jr, by comparison, compared mask mandates to "Nazi experiments on Jews in concentration camps".
